Western Cape Highlights
Table Mountain
Incredible panoramic vistas are only a cable car ride or a trek away, with trails leading to the top of this iconic mountain.Kirstenbosch National Botanical Garden
Swaths of South Africa’s native flora can be found at the foot of Table Mountain, where thousands of diverse plants flourish.Boulders Beach penguin colony
Endangered African penguins make their home in Boulders Beach’s sheltered inlets, popping out to play in the gentle waves.Cape Point and the Cape of Good Hope
Troops of baboons roam the Cape of Good Hope’s rugged landscape as visitors take the chance to explore Cape Point's unspoiled beaches.Robben Island
Walk in the shadows of Nelson Mandela at this UNESCO World Heritage Site and visit the museum's exhibits.Whale watching in Hermanus
Whale watching tours depart from Hermanus during winter or spring and give wildlife enthusiasts the chance to marvel at the majestic southern right whales.The Cape Winelands
Jagged mountains and serene countryside provide the scenic backdrop for a journey to the world-class vineyards peppered throughout the Cape Winelands.Cango Caves in Oudtshoorn
Limestone formations cascade from the ceilings and creep up from the floors of these wondrous caves that wind through Oudtshoorn’s crags.Garden Route
The Garden Route runs along South Africa’s south-eastern coast and boasts lush scenery, pristine lagoons and rocky highlands.
